Transaction 659882040f5382ce404ef36cd367fd90422b456e101c3769c43a8ccf860e9419

1 Input
2 Outputs
  • 659882040f5382ce404ef36cd367fd90422b456e101c3769c43a8ccf860e9419:0
  • value  183600
    address  35U3rSzQ7eKxVWEoAqp5dYt3vGaB7FP9aP
  • 659882040f5382ce404ef36cd367fd90422b456e101c3769c43a8ccf860e9419:1
  • value  4496
    address  bc1qa0tv4mculv9vn0qewfflhmh86cv6kh4verrec3